Tom Jones

Summary

Tom Jones is a human[1]. His place of birth was Pontypridd[2]. He was born on June 7, 1940[3]. He worked as a singer[4]. He ranks in the top 0.21% of human entities by monthly Wikipedia readership (6,378 views/month, #2,089 of 1,000,298).[5]

Recognition

Awards received include Officer of the Order of the British Empire[10], a grade of an order[28], in United Kingdom[29]; Grammy Award for Best New Artist[11], a class of award[30], in United States[31], founded in 1959[32]; Knight Bachelor[12], a title of honor[33], in United Kingdom[34], founded in 1300[35]; and star on Hollywood Walk of Fame[13], a commemorative plaque[36], in United States[37].
